What Are Sliding Windows?
Sliding windows, likewise referred to as gliding windows, are designed to open and close by moving horizontally. They usually include 2 sashes, one of which is fixed, and the other slides along a track. These windows are preferred for their ease of operation, energy efficiency, and capability to supply sufficient natural light and ventilation.
Typical Issues with Sliding Windows
Before diving into repair methods, it's necessary to understand the typical concerns that can arise with moving windows. Here are a few of the most frequent issues:
Difficulty in Opening and Closing
Causes: Debris in the track, misaligned sashes, or worn-out rollers.Signs: The window may stick or refuse to move smoothly.
Air Leaks
Causes: Worn weatherstripping, gaps in between the sash and frame, or harmed seals.Signs: Drafts, increased energy expenses, and discomfort.
Water Leaks

Repairing moving windows can typically be finished with standard tools and a bit of patience. Here are some detailed guides to deal with the typical issues:
1. Problem in Opening and Closing
Action 1: Clean the Tracks
Utilize a vacuum cleaner to get rid of particles from the tracks.For stubborn dirt, use a solution of mild meal soap and water, then scrub with a soft brush.Rinse and dry the tracks thoroughly.
Step 2: Lubricate the Rollers
Apply a silicone-based lube to the rollers to ensure smooth motion.Prevent using oil-based lubricants, as they can draw in dirt and grime.
Action 3: Adjust the Sash
If the window is misaligned, you might need to change the sash. This can often be done by loosening the screws on the roller brackets and repositioning the sash.Tighten the screws once the sash is aligned.2. Air Leaks
Action 1: Inspect the Weatherstripping
Look for used, harmed, or missing weatherstripping.Replace any harmed strips with brand-new ones, guaranteeing they fit snugly.
Step 2: Seal Gaps
Usage caulk or weatherstripping to seal any spaces between the sash and the frame.Ensure the seal is continuous and airtight.3. Water Leaks
Action 1: Check the Seals
Examine the seals around the window for damage.Replace any broken seals with brand-new ones.
Action 2: Clean the Drainage Holes
Find the drainage holes at the bottom of the window frame.Utilize a wire or a small brush to clear any debris or obstructions.
Step 3: Seal the Frame
Use a silicone sealant around the frame to avoid water from seeping in.4. Broken or Loose Hardware
Step 1: Tighten Loose Screws
Use a screwdriver to tighten any loose screws on the manages, locks, or latches.If the screws are removed, utilize longer screws or a screw anchor to secure them.
Step 2: Replace Broken Parts
If any hardware is broken, replace it with a new part from a hardware shop.Guarantee the replacement part matches the initial in size and function.5. Condensation
Action 1: Improve Insulation
Think about including a layer of insulating film or double-glazed windows to minimize condensation.Make sure the seals around the window are tight and airtight.
Action 2: Use a Dehumidifier
Place a dehumidifier in the room to reduce wetness levels.Frequently check and clear the dehumidifier to maintain ideal efficiency.Maintenance Tips for Sliding Windows
Routine maintenance can significantly extend the life of your sliding windows and prevent numerous typical concerns. Here are some suggestions to keep your windows in leading condition:
Clean the Tracks Regularly: Use a vacuum and a soft brush to remove particles from the tracks at least once a year.Lubricate the Rollers: Apply a silicone-based lubricant to the rollers every six months to ensure smooth operation.Check the Seals: Check the weatherstripping and seals for damage or use at least when a year and replace as needed.Inspect the Hardware: Tighten any loose screws and replace broken hardware to ensure the window runs correctly.Preserve Proper Ventilation: Use a dehumidifier and guarantee the space is well-ventilated to prevent condensation.Frequently asked questions
Q: How frequently should I clean the tracks of my sliding windows?A: It's recommended to clean the tracks a minimum of when a year to avoid debris accumulation and guarantee smooth operation.
Q: Can I utilize oil to lube the rollers?A: No, it's finest to utilize a silicone-based lube, as oil can attract dirt and gunk, leading to further problems.
Q: What should I do if my moving window is leaking water?A: First, examine the seals and clean the drainage holes. If the problem continues, think about replacing the seals or seeking advice from an expert.
Q: How can I prevent condensation on my sliding windows?A: Improve insulation, use a dehumidifier, and ensure the room is well-ventilated to lower moisture levels.
Q: Can I replace the weatherstripping myself?A: Yes, with the right tools and products, you can replace weatherstripping yourself. Guarantee the brand-new strips fit snugly and are set up properly.
